Security Police Officer – Contingent – Trinity Health Ann Arbor
Part‑time, rotating shifts. The primary responsibility is to ensure a safe and secure environment for patients, staff, and visitors at SJMHS‑West Market.
Essential Functions and Responsibilities- Represents the Health System by providing assistance and guidance to all patients, staff and visitors to the SJMHS West Market Campuses.
- Patrols and monitors the internal and external activities of the grounds, parking lots, structures, and buildings to ensure compliance with health center policies, state law, and federal laws, responding to and reporting any violations to a command officer. Responds to any reports of criminal activity and effects arrests as appropriate within the parameters of security police policy/procedures, state and federal law, and Michigan Commission of Law Enforcement Standards (MCOLES);
utilizing the necessary force to effect arrest, using handcuffs and other restraints in accordance with department procedures, policies and regulations. - Responds to a variety of potential and/or real emergencies, fire and building alarms, events (patient standby/restraint), person(s) with weapons, medical emergencies, and/or any other public safety related incident.
- Exercises reasonable independent judgment within legal parameters of law to determine when there is reasonable suspicion to detain and/or search, when probable cause exists to arrest, and the appropriate application of force used to preserve life and property.
- Completes a daily activity report documenting non‑routine activities for referral to the appropriate manager.
- Completes a written report involving a complaint and/or investigation of criminal activity, violation of security policy and procedure, suspicious activity, and/or any incident involving the use of force. The Security Police Officer shall utilize the appropriate documenting procedures and complete the report in its entirety.
- Completes as assigned all defibrillator and vehicle maintenance checks.
- Maintains all security police equipment in working condition. Proactively recognizes and reports to command officer any safety risks and/or hazards and when possible takes immediate action to reduce or remove the risk and/or hazard.
- Responds to complaints generated by patients, staff, and visitors including reports of lost property, suspicious activity, improper access and suspicious packages.
- Responds to general assist calls generated by patients, staff, and visitors, including locking/unlocking doors, vehicle lockouts and jumpstarts, wheelchair assists, and/or any customer service‑related issues.
- Reports to Grounds any parking lot gates not functioning properly. Issues citations for improper parking, handicap, and fire lane violations.
- Self‑reports to a command officer any off‑duty police contact, arrests, and court orders such as Injunctions, Personal Protection Orders, and legal proceedings that would prevent the Security Police Officer from owning, possessing, or carrying a firearm i.e., Domestic Violence Order, or conditional bond release. Failure to report this information will result in immediate termination.
- Maintains a working knowledge of applicable Federal, State, local laws and regulations applicable to their role, Trinity Health Standards of Conduct, the Organizational Integrity Program, Security Police policy and procedure, and any related policies and procedures pertaining to the adherence of behavior that reflects honest, ethical, and professional behavior.
- High School diploma or equivalent, associate degree preferred.
- Minimum 1 year of experience in campus security/police, military, or law enforcement preferred.
- Successfully complete and pass a psychological evaluation.
- Current MCOLES license preferred or ability to pass MCOLES PA330 Academy Training within six months of hire date or the first available academy.
- Maintain the qualifications required by MCOLES and the State of Michigan.>
- Maintain a valid, unrestricted Michigan driver's license.
